The "perspective effect" a lens (indirectly) stems from its angle. Or more precisely: from the influence that has this angle in practice on the shooting location. You stop on the same point, the image is clipped only by using a Cropformates, you go further for the same object size, change the perspective. A difference between 75 mm Follvormat and 50mm crop in "Perspective effect" does not exist.

1.die the will perspective through the distance from object to recording level determined.
2.der cut out is determined by the focal length (to the recording format)
